Prevent unwanted bathroom odour with eucalyptus oil

Posted by UrbanGreenGirl

eucalytpus They’re in everyone’s bathroom, those toxic, aerosol, air fresheners for after washroom use. We know they can cause respiratory problems, and the residue can also be harmful to  small children and pets who crawl on the floor.  To top that off, not only are these air fresheners not environmentally friendly, but their containers cannot be recycled which means more waste for the landfill. Thus, I have a great solution that is not only environmentally friendly and cost effective, but really prevents that “hide your head in your shirt because it smells so bad”, odour. Just drop a few drops of eucalyptus oil in the toilet before use and voilà, bye-bye stinky odour. The bathroom will be left smelling like a fresh rainforest of eucalyptus trees instead of that awful fake rose air freshener smell that reminds you of your grandma’s washroom! You can find eucalyptus oil in any place that sells aromatherapy oils, candle shops, pharmacies or health food stores.  Once finished, the eucalytpus bottle can also be recycled because they’re usually made of glass.
